Unhappy selinoid clicks but cart is dead

I have a 2003 club car.. I use as at a seasonal camp grounds.. In 2013 I replaced all 6 (8volt) batteries and the controller... Last year it stopped and I was told it was the computer so I purchased a new charger to by pass the computer.. I just got it out of storage and it took right off.. After a couple of trips around the yard it started smelling hot so I parked it for a couple of days.. The next time I went out it took right off but after a little joy ride it started smelling hot again and stopped!
I am wondering if it is the motor and if since it is a 2003 and I have already put over a thousand into it (I am a 70 year old widow so have to hire most work done) it might be better to replace it (even though I really don't have the money)

Default Re: selinoid clicks but cart is dead

This is going to require a little more investigation on somebody's part to ascertain which component is getting hot and giving off the smell. Next time you smell hot electrical lift the seat and see if you can locate the source or have a technician do it for you. The trouble could be in the F&R mechanism or any bad cable connection....
